Transaction 3911a229fe9c6616aa7eceee60d65e5a856bcc80de8f46720b30166417f83e33

2 Input
1 Outputs
  • 3911a229fe9c6616aa7eceee60d65e5a856bcc80de8f46720b30166417f83e33:0
  • value  268649828
    address  3CkhcMXfVs8WUBTmtJNkCdhXpgSU2nmNiA